Kind of reinforces what I was thinking. A good set of 265's, mild 2" quality suspension lift, and recovery equipment to start my build. After a while I'll toss in some lockers front and rear. The more i think about it the more I want this rig to be something I can throw my family in and drive across country while getting off the beaten path whenever possible, without worrying about getting stranded in the middle of nowhere.
On that note, I definitely want to add a second battery in there. How do you guys do it? I was thinking have a very basic setup with a simple knife switch so I can isolate it from the circuit when we setup camp. Basically an emergency backup in case we run the primary dry. I would need both on a switch at this point to eliminate the load of a dead battery when trying to start.

most guys use a marine grade transfer switch to isolate the aux battery.
